How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 30336?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
30336 Studio Apartments | $1,423 | $899 | $1,889 |
30336 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,421 | $857 | $2,204 |
30336 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,601 | $1,050 | $3,347 |
30336 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,980 | $651 | $5,100 |
30336 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,416 | $701 | $1,799 |
